Do you recognise these men?
British Transport Police (BTP) detectives investigating a sexual assault on board an Elizabeth Line train are releasing images of two men they would like to speak to.
At just before 11pm on Saturday 6 June, a group of buskers boarded an eastbound service at Whitechapel station.
During the journey, two men from the group sexually assaulted a woman.
They then got off the train at the next stop - Stratford station
Detectives believe the men in the images may have information that will assist their ongoing investigation.
Anyone who recognises them, or witnesses the assault, can contact BTP by texting 61016 or calling 0800 40 50 40, quoting reference 860 of 6 June.
Information can be given anonymously to Crimestoppers on 0800 555 111.
